原文:【MySQL】为什么SQL会这么慢

建表 插入数据 索引 sql执行慢,第一想法就是加个索引呗。但有时尽管加了索引了,为什么执行还是这么慢的呢。这就要问你真正使用对了索引没有了。我们一般可以使用EXPLAIN来查看是否sql执行时是否使用了索引。对于索引还不怎么清楚的同学,建议你自行查看下我的上一篇文章 MySQL 索引 . 对索引字段进行了函数操作 a字段上面建有索引,图 中对a字段进行了运算,图 中没有对a字段进行运算。 从结果 ...

2019-09-11 20:03 1 621 推荐指数:

查看详情

如何分析MysqlSQL

内容摘要: 开启查询日志捕获SQL 使用explain分析SQL 使用show profile查询SQL执行细节 常见的SQL语句优化 一、开启查询日志捕获SQL ① 查询mysql是否开启日志捕获:SHOW VARIABLES ...

Mon Oct 29 18:22:00 CST 2018 0 1778
MySQL如何定位sql

MySQL如何定位sql MySQLSQL”定位 数据库调优我个人觉得必须要明白两件事 1.定位问题(你得知道问题出在哪里,要不然从哪里调优呢) 2.解决问题(这个没有基本的方法来处理,因为不同的问题处理的方式方法不一样,得从实践中不断的探索 ...

Sun Dec 22 00:08:00 CST 2019 0 1876
MySQLSQL”定位

MySQLSQL”定位 这一篇文章将会教会你如何来定位一个查询的sql,如果你是一个初学者,很想知道在mysql 中如何来定位哪些sql语句是花时间最长的。 步骤1:查询是否开启了查询 步骤2:设置查询的时间限制 步骤3:查看查询 ...

Wed May 11 19:44:00 CST 2016 0 1838
MySQL - 查看SQL

查看MySQL是否启用了查看SQL的日志文件 (1) 查看SQL日志是否启用 mysql> show variables like 'log_slow_queries'; +------------------+-------+| Variable_name | Value ...

Thu Jul 19 05:08:00 CST 2012 0 10926
Mysql查看SQL

SQL监控默认都是关的 SHOW VARIABLES LIKE '%slow%'; SHOW VARIABLES LIKE '%slow_query_log%'; 查看SQL日志位置 show variables like ...

Fri Dec 03 22:59:00 CST 2021 0 1031
mysqlsql查询

原文链接:https://blog.csdn.net/weixin_30995429/article/details/114798804 Mysql中 查询Sql语句的记录查找 查询日志 slow_query_log,是用来记录查询比较慢的sql语句,通过查询日志来查找哪条sql语句 ...

Thu Apr 14 16:16:00 CST 2022 0 2895
MySQL日志分析SQL

日志 MySQL查询日志是MySQL提供一种日志记录,它用来记录MySQL中响应时间超过阈值的语句具体指运行时间超过long_query_time值的SQL,则会被记录到日志中 具体指运行时间超过long_query_time值得SQL,则会被记录到查询日志中 ...

Sun Mar 15 19:31:00 CST 2020 0 2003
mysql 查询 SQL 记录和调整

mysql 中,可以通过设置配置参数,开启 SQL 的记录 在 my.cnf 的 [mysqld] 配置下,可以设置以下参数实现查询记录 NOTE: log_output 参数默认为:file,代表保存在文件中 如果设置了将SQL 保存在 table中 ...

Sat Aug 08 23:11:00 CST 2020 1 1522
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M